BLDC-motor driven E-Skateboard (TAPAS powered)

E-skateboard powered with Siemens SDI TAPAS, a 48 V GaN based three phase community inverter board with onboard filters.

Quick-Start Guide SDI TAPAS Community Inverter

This quick-start-guide will lead you through the necessary steps to get TAPAS up and running with most commercially available DC-brushless motors. If you are new to Texas Instruments DSPs or power conversion, we advise you to start with this guide. It will take you through the necessary steps to set-up your (coding) environment and bring the board to life. You are then free to explore the endless possibilities that the platform provides.
